The Theatre Practice is looking for a PRODUCTION COORDINATOR to join our producing and production team!
A production coordinator is responsible for ensuring the production team completes technical goals, safely and on time. Your daily duties include planning, scheduling and executing production-related preparations for all Practice programmes. Other duties may include the research and development of production delivery mediums and methods.
Roles & Responsibilities
A. Overall:
- You will be joining the Programming & Production Team
- You will be reporting to the Programming & Production Team Lead and Technical Director.
- You will be collaborating with colleagues from all departments in The Theatre Practice (Practice). You will be required to participate in non-production events, including but not limited to meetings, team brainstorming sessions and celebratory events
B. Practice Productions and Programmes:
- You will be involved in coordinating and / or executing technical preparation for Practice’s productions including main season programming, festivals, school and community productions.
- You will collaborate with external and in-house Production Manager(s) and Stage Manager(s) in managing production preparations and presentations.
- You will partake in assigned Practice productions and events. This includes but is not limited to coordinating resource usage, recruiting manpower and setting up production elements across different mediums.
- You are required to review, organise and archive final technical documentations / deliverables to the best of your ability.
- You will work with external technical contractors/suppliers in executing production elements. You will work together with the administration team to oversee the working conditions and security of the venue and existing inventory
C. Venue Hire Productions and Events:
- You will be leading communications with external parties with regards to venue hire productions and events.
- You will assist in the maintenance of all equipment and restoration of all spaces in Practice to ensure a safe, tidy and welcoming working environment.
- You will be involved in coordinating both Practice's and venue hire events to ensure that said event(s) run smoothly, including but not limited to de-conflicting the usage of space and equipment.
- You will support the Technical Director in evaluating the production needs of the venue hirer.
- You will work with the administration team in generating venue reports for relevant stakeholders.
- You will manage venue managers who oversee the working condition and security of the venue and inventory during productions and events.

Production Scheduling
Develop and maintain production schedules based on customer orders.
Coordinate with different departments (Sales, Purchasing, Engineering, QA, Production) to ensure timely availability of materials and capacity.
Material Planning & Inventory Control
Ensure all raw materials, components, and tools are available on time to meet production needs.
Work closely with store/logistics teams to monitor stock levels and avoid shortages or overstocking.
Order Tracking & Status Updates
Monitor work orders and ensure timely completion of production jobs.
Update stakeholders on production progress and address any delays or issues.
Communication & Coordination
Act as the liaison between various teams: production floor, quality, logistics, and customer service.
Resolve conflicts in schedules, material constraints, or unexpected machine downtime.
Documentation & Reporting
Maintain accurate records of production plans, work orders, and changes.
Generate reports for management on production output, efficiency, and delivery performance.
Continuous Improvement
Identify bottlenecks or inefficiencies and suggest improvements to planning or production flow.
Work closely with engineers and supervisors to implement process improvements.
Experience in production planning or manufacturing coordination , ideally in electro-plating (based on Richport’s industry).
Proficient in Microsoft Excel, Outlook and ERP/MRP systems.
Strong organization and problem-solving skills .
Able to work under pressure and manage multiple priorities .
Good interpersonal and communication skills to interact with all levels of staff.

Key Responsibilities:
- Assist to prepare and organize production job sheets and related documentation.
- Update production records promptly to maintain accuracy and traceability.
- Coordinate with printing, finishing, binding departments and external vendors to ensure smooth production workflow.
- Operate small digital printing machines (e.g., Konica Minolta) to ensure consistent output quality.
- Monitor inventory of printing materials (plates, paper, ink, chemicals, etc.) and report shortages or issues.
- Assist in troubleshooting minor issues on the production floor and escalate technical problems when needed.
- Follow up on production timelines for customer orders to ensure timely delivery and quality compliance.
- Adhere to company safety protocols and keep the workplace clean and organized.
- Perform other duties as assigned by the Production Manager.
